Who can use?
Night Nurse can be used by adults and children aged over 16 years old.
How to use?
Adults and children aged over 16 years old
- Take 20ml using the measure cup (or take four 5ml teaspoons) just before bedtime
- Do not drink alcohol while taking Night Nurse
- Only use one dose of Night Nurse per night
- Do not take for more than 7 nights. Prolonged use may be harmful
Do not take Night Nurse if any of the following apply
- If you have ever had an allergic reaction to paracetamol, promethazine, dextromethorpan or any of the other ingredients.
- If you have severe high blood pressure, severe heart disease, sever liver disease or severe kidney disease
- If you have pneumonia, asthma or severe respiratory problems
- If you are having a pregnancy test carried out on your urine
- If you have taken monoamine oxidase inhibitors (MAOIs) in the last two weeks
If you are pregnant or breast-feeding.
Do not take Night Nurse Liquid if you are pregnant or if you are breastfeeding.
Possible side effects
This product will cause drowsiness. Do not drive or operate machinery when affected by drowsiness or dizziness.
This medication can have side-effects, like all medicines, although these are usually mild and do not affect everyone. If you experience any side-effects, please talk to your doctor.
Immediate medical advice should be sought in the event of an overdose, even if you feel well.
